Introduction

PeopleDAO is a decentralized autonomous organization that operates on the Ethereum blockchain. It is run by a group of individuals who have come together to create a community-driven platform for investing in decentralized finance (DeFi) projects. The governance structure of PeopleDAO is designed to be transparent, efficient, and inclusive, with several key roles and teams working together to make important decisions and drive the organization forward.

Roles in PeopleDAO

PeopleDAO has several key roles that help to keep the organization running smoothly and effectively. These roles include:

  1. Administrators

Administrators are responsible for maintaining the technical infrastructure of PeopleDAO, including its smart contracts and website. They play a crucial role in ensuring the security and stability of the platform, and are also involved in the development of new features and functionality.

  1. Multisig

The multisig is a group of individuals who are elected to manage the funds of PeopleDAO. The term period of the multisig is determined by the community, and the number of signers can vary depending on the needs of the organization. The responsibilities of the multisig include managing the funds of PeopleDAO, making investment decisions, and overseeing the distribution of profits to contributors.

  1. Team (co-)leads

Team leads are responsible for managing and coordinating the efforts of specific teams within PeopleDAO. They work closely with the other teams and help to ensure that everyone is working towards the same goals and objectives.

  1. Moderators

Moderators are responsible for maintaining the community guidelines and ensuring that discussions remain respectful and productive. They also play a key role in mediating disputes and ensuring that everyone has a voice in the decision-making process.

  1. Active Contributors

Active contributors are the heart of PeopleDAO. They contribute to the organization in a variety of ways, including participating in discussions, developing and implementing new ideas, and helping to spread the word about PeopleDAO.

Teams in PeopleDAO

PeopleDAO has several teams that work together to achieve its goals and objectives. These teams include:

  • Marketing

  • Investment

  • Operations

  • Development

  • Community

Each team is led by a team lead who works closely with the other teams to ensure that everyone is working towards the same goals and objectives. Teams also collaborate on projects and initiatives to help drive the organization forward.

Major Community Meeting Events

PeopleDAO regularly holds two major community meeting events: the Contributor Call and the Fireside Chat. The Contributor Call is an opportunity for contributors to come together and discuss the latest developments in the world of DeFi and share their thoughts and ideas. The Fireside Chat is a more informal event where contributors can have casual conversations and get to know one another better. Both events are an important part of PeopleDAO's governance structure, as they help to foster a sense of community and ensure that everyone has a voice in the decision-making process.
